Epoxy flooring involves applying a resin coating to a concrete subfloor, creating a hard, moisture-resistant, and glossy surface. You need this primarily for garages, basements, or utility spaces where you need high durability and easy cleanup. The process involves cleaning the concrete, etching it for adhesion, and then applying multiple layers of the epoxy mixture. It is an excellent choice for preventing oil stains and resisting heavy impact, making your concrete floor much easier to maintain over time.

Vinyl plank is typically more resistant to water and scratches than laminate, making it a good choice for busy households. Laminate can offer a wood-like appearance but is more susceptible to moisture damage.
